My Only Way Out

How far will you go, Will you kill me ? At least then I’d finally be free, Your concisely discreet with the people we meet, But we both know your not what they see. I’m trapped inside your twisted Eden, Where you force me to bend to your will, Where your free to give me a beating, Or use me till you’ve had your fill. So for all of the pain that you cause me, Every echo that’s heard in this rhyme, Take this admission of guilt, for blood will be spilt, So I can be free to pay for my crime.
